Discovering Novalja, Croatia
Novalja, Croatia, is a hidden gem waiting to be discovered! It’s famous for its beautiful beaches like Zrće Beach, where you can swim in clear blue water or enjoy fun music festivals. The town is also filled with delicious local food, including fresh seafood and tasty pastries that you can try at cozy restaurants.
There are so many fun things to do in Novalja! You can visit the ancient ruins of the Roman aqueduct, which tells stories from long ago. Nature lovers can explore the nearby Paklenica National Park, perfect for hiking and seeing amazing wildlife. Don’t miss out on a boat trip to nearby islands like Pag, where you can find stunning landscapes and more lovely beaches.
